Benton Township is a township in Minnehaha County, South Dakota, United States. The population was 778 at the 2020 census. [2]
Benton Township has a total area of 31.357 square miles (81.21 km2), of which 31.343 square miles (81.18 km2) is land and 0.014 square miles (0.036 km2) is water. [3]
As of the 2023 American Community Survey, there were an estimated 285 households. [4]
